My kids have been coughing non-stop for the past week and we can't figure out why. I finally pulled out the sofa in our villa's living room, which is against an external wall, and found a huge patch of black, fuzzy mold spreading from the corner where we had that small leak during the last heavy rain. I’m panicking because they play on that floor all the time. What’s the absolute fastest way to deal with this safely and who should I call to check if it’s the dangerous kind?

Based on your description, this is a serious situation requiring immediate professional intervention. The combination of a water intrusion event (the leak), visible black fungal growth, and the health symptoms in your children are strong indicators of a problematic mold infestation that should not be handled by yourself.

For accurate identification, you must call a certified mold inspector. In the UAE, professionals use advanced tools like moisture meters, thermal imaging cameras, and most critically, air and surface sampling. These samples are sent to an accredited laboratory (such as those compliant with DM or Dubai Municipality regulations) to determine the species (e.g., whether it is Stachybotrys chartarum, the "toxic black mold," or another species) and the spore concentration in your indoor air. This scientific analysis is the only way to confirm the type and danger level.

For the fastest and safest removal, the remediation process must be handled by a licensed company. DIY attempts can aerosolize spores, spreading the contamination throughout your villa and exacerbating health issues. A proper remediation will involve setting up containment with negative air pressure, using HEPA filtration scrubbers, safely removing and disposing of contaminated materials, and a thorough hygienization of the area. This is not a simple cleaning task.
